    copied!<p>JCodec ( <a href="http://jcodec.org" rel="nofollow">http://jcodec.org</a>) is what you are looking for. It's an open source pure java video codec library. It doesn't support AVI at the moment but IMHO MP4 format is better suited for H.264 anyway. </p> <p>In case you decide to go with JCodec, here's a sample class you can use:</p> <pre><code>public class SequenceEncoder { private SeekableByteChannel ch; private Picture toEncode; private RgbToYuv420 transform; private H264Encoder encoder; private ArrayList&lt;ByteBuffer&gt; spsList; private ArrayList&lt;ByteBuffer&gt; ppsList; private CompressedTrack outTrack; private ByteBuffer _out; private int frameNo; private MP4Muxer muxer; public SequenceEncoder(File out) throws IOException { this.ch = NIOUtils.writableFileChannel(out); // Transform to convert between RGB and YUV transform = new RgbToYuv420(0, 0); // Muxer that will store the encoded frames muxer = new MP4Muxer(ch, Brand.MP4); // Add video track to muxer outTrack = muxer.addTrackForCompressed(TrackType.VIDEO, 25); // Allocate a buffer big enough to hold output frames _out = ByteBuffer.allocate(1920 * 1080 * 6); // Create an instance of encoder encoder = new H264Encoder(); // Encoder extra data ( SPS, PPS ) to be stored in a special place of // MP4 spsList = new ArrayList&lt;ByteBuffer&gt;(); ppsList = new ArrayList&lt;ByteBuffer&gt;(); } public void encodeImage(BufferedImage bi) throws IOException { if (toEncode == null) { toEncode = Picture.create(bi.getWidth(), bi.getHeight(), ColorSpace.YUV420); } // Perform conversion for (int i = 0; i &lt; 3; i++) Arrays.fill(toEncode.getData()[i], 0); transform.transform(AWTUtil.fromBufferedImage(bi), toEncode); // Encode image into H.264 frame, the result is stored in '_out' buffer _out.clear(); ByteBuffer result = encoder.encodeFrame(_out, toEncode); // Based on the frame above form correct MP4 packet spsList.clear(); ppsList.clear(); H264Utils.encodeMOVPacket(result, spsList, ppsList); // Add packet to video track outTrack.addFrame(new MP4Packet(result, frameNo, 25, 1, frameNo, true, null, frameNo, 0)); frameNo++; } public void finish() throws IOException { // Push saved SPS/PPS to a special storage in MP4 outTrack.addSampleEntry(H264Utils.createMOVSampleEntry(spsList, ppsList)); // Write MP4 header and finalize recording muxer.writeHeader(); NIOUtils.closeQuietly(ch); } public static void main(String[] args) throws IOException { SequenceEncoder encoder = new SequenceEncoder(new File("video.mp4")); for (int i = 1; i &lt; 100; i++) { BufferedImage bi = ImageIO.read(new File(String.format("folder/img%08d.png", i))); encoder.encodeImage(bi); } encoder.finish(); } } </code></pre>
